Slugs Manager Troubleshooting

No Old Slugs Found

  • While this message is positive, it’s good practice to occasionally refresh the list (click “Refresh List”) to ensure the information is up-to-date.

If you suspect there might be old slugs, consider these options

  • Manually update permalinks: Go to Settings > Permalinks and click “Save Changes” to regenerate permalinks. This might reveal old ones.
  • Check another plugin: Another plugin could be creating the old slugs. Try temporarily deactivating other plugins to isolate the issue.

Automatic Clean Ups Not Working (Pro Version)

  • Verify Pro Activation: Ensure you have activated the Slugs Manager Pro plugin with a valid license.
  • Check Scheduled Tasks: Some hosting providers limit scheduled tasks. Contact your hosting provider to confirm if scheduled cleanups are supported.
  • Cron Jobs: If your hosting uses cron jobs, ensure they are configured correctly for Slugs Manager Pro to run its scheduled tasks. You might need to consult your hosting provider for assistance.
  • Plugin Conflicts: Try temporarily deactivating other plugins to see if a conflict is preventing automatic cleanups.

Clean Up on Save Post Not Working (Pro Version)

  • Pro Version Activated: Double-check that you have activated the Pro version and have the necessary features enabled.
  • Plugin Conflicts: Similar to automatic cleanups, deactivate other plugins to identify potential conflicts.
  • Permissions: In rare cases, permission issues might prevent the plugin from modifying the database. Check with your hosting provider if this is a possibility.

Regenerate Slugs Not Working (Pro Version)

  • Pro Version Activated: Confirm you have activated the Slugs Manager Pro plugin.
  • Plugin Conflicts: Deactivate other plugins to see if a conflict is hindering the regeneration process.
  • Large Datasets: Regenerating slugs for a massive amount of content can take time. Be patient and allow the process to complete, especially for large websites.
  • Server Issues: If the regeneration process times out or encounters errors, your web server might be overloaded. Contact your hosting provider for assistance.
